#a5061c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#a5061c is composed of 64.7% red, 2.4% green and 11%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 96.4% magenta, 83% yellow and 35.3% black. It has a hue angle of 351.7 degrees, a saturation of 93% and a lightness of 33.5%. #a5061c color hex could be obtained by blending #ff0c38 with #4b0000. Closest websafe color is: #990033.

Shades and Tints of #a5061c

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0e0002 is the darkest color, while #fffafa is the lightest one.

Tones of #a5061c

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#565555 is the less saturated color, while #a5061c is the most saturated one.
